Slab Leak Detection: Common Problems, Causes & Warning Signs in Welling, OK
Slab leaks can be difficult to detect but there are key warning signs to watch for. Increased water bills, damp spots on floors, or the sound of running water when all taps are off may indicate a leak. Addressing these symptoms promptly can save homeowners from extensive damage and costly repairs. The underlying conditions, such as aging pipes or shifts in the foundation, also need careful evaluation to determine the right repair approach.

Water Bill Increase
A sudden spike in your water bill often signals a slab leak. Address this promptly to avoid increasing damage costs.
Floor and Ceiling Damage
Damp spots or discoloration on floors or ceilings may indicate water seepage from beneath your slab.
Running Water Noise
Hearing water running in silence points to a potential leak. Immediate investigation could mitigate further issues.
Foundation Shifts
Visible cracks or shifts in the foundation can suggest leaks. Evaluation of these areas is crucial for repair.

Common Questions About Slab Leak Detection
These FAQs clarify common concerns regarding slab leaks and our detection services.
What causes a slab leak?
Slab leaks can occur due to corrosion, shifting soil, or physical damage to pipes under the slab, often exacerbated by age or unsuitable materials.
How can I identify if I have a slab leak?
Look for wet spots, increased water bills, running water sounds, or cracks in the foundation, as these are common signs of slab leaks.
What should I do if I suspect a slab leak?
Contact a professional as soon as possible to assess the situation accurately and recommend the best course of action to prevent further damage.
Do slab leaks always cause visible damage?
Not always; some leaks may go unnoticed initially, but they can lead to hidden damage over time. Early detection is key.
Is slab leak detection invasive?
Modern detection methods are generally non-invasive, allowing for accurate diagnosis without major disruptions to your property.
What are the long-term impacts of ignoring slab leaks?
Ignoring slab leaks can lead to extensive water damage, mold growth, and significant foundation issues, resulting in costly repairs.
